Output cb61fc2fa82fc815558a3742e72ed3f65489a4e5c68df643bb948e5b3755309e:29

value
732382
script pubkey
OP_0 OP_PUSHBYTES_20 dfec3ac1e83638ee3eff2c69a1cac08abdc5b485
address
bc1qmlkr4s0gxcuwu0hl9356rjkq327utdy9eefyau
transaction
cb61fc2fa82fc815558a3742e72ed3f65489a4e5c68df643bb948e5b3755309e
confirmations
217616
spent
true